‘Pletenica’— This is a beautiful 6-Braid Slovenian sweet bread. It would make a perfect addition on your holiday table. Dober tek!
1 3/4 cups water
1 1/2 packages active dry yeast (about 3 1/2 tsp’s)
1/2 cup sugar plus 1 Tbsp
1/2 cup vegetable or canola oil
5 large eggs
1 tablespoon salt
8 to 8 1/2 cups AP Robin Hood flour
*optional: Poppy or sesame seeds for sprinkling on top
1. In a large bowl, dissolve yeast and 1 Tbsp sugar in 1 3/4 cups lukewarm water
2. Whisk oil in yeast and beat in 4 eggs one at a time. Slowly add in remaining sugar and salt. Gradually add in 8 cups of flour, add in more about 1 Tbsp at a time. When dough holds together and comes off the bowl it’s is ready for kneading. (You can use a mixer with a dough hook both both mixing and kneading.
3. Turn dough into a floured surface and knead until dough is smooth. Crease a large bowl with oil, return dough to bowl. Cover and let rise in a warm place for 1 hour until doubled in size. I like to place a the oven with the light on. After one hour, punch down dough, cover and let rise for another 30 minutes
4. Divide and braid the dough using a 6 braid pattern. (YouTube has step by step tutorials - Amy Kanarek's bread braiding demo is really easy to follow)
5. Let rise for one hour. Then brush loaves with egg wash.
6. Bake in a 375F oven for 35-40 minutes until nice and golden. Cool loaves on a rack.
